Wanted urgently as I'm stuck in the middle of a retro fit power steering install and would like to know if anyone has a crank pulley suitable for power steering with the correct spacing for sale as my one appears to be incorrect?

Part numbers required 603711 & 602587 individual parts or whole assembly if available?

If all else fails you could have a spacer made to go between the crank pulley and your current auxilliary pulley to bring it into line.

I have auxilliary pulleys but they're all from Land/Range Rovers, so although some have the offset you're looking for they are bigger diameter. I'm sure I sold the last P6B one I had to someone on here.
